Как создавать свой сайт и дизайн? - коротко
Создание собственного сайта и дизайна включает в себя выбор платформы для разработки (например, WordPress или Wix) и определение целевой аудитории для создания уникального и функционального интерфейса. Важно учитывать современные тенденции дизайна и обеспечить удобство навигации для пользователей.
Как создавать свой сайт и дизайн? - развернуто
Создание собственного сайта и его дизайна требует комплексного подхода, включающего несколько ключевых этапов: планирование, разработка контента, выбор технологий, создание макетов и их реализация.
На первом этапе необходимо провести анализ целей и задач сайта. Это включает определение целевой аудитории, основных функций сайта (информационная, коммерческая, блог и так далее.) и ключевых сообщений, которые будут передаваться пользователям. Важно также учитывать конкурентный анализ, чтобы понять, что предлагают конкуренты и как можно выделиться на фоне них.
После завершения планирования следует приступить к созданию контента. Тексты должны быть информативными, легко читаемыми и оптимизированными для поисковых систем (SEO). Визуальные элементы, такие как изображения и видео, также играют важную роль в привлечении внимания пользователей.
Выбор технологий зависит от типа сайта и требований к функциональности. Для простых информационных сайтов могут подойти редакционные системы (CMS) типа WordPress или Joomla. Для более сложных проектов с уникальной функциональностью может потребоваться разработка на основе фреймворков, таких как Django для Python или Laravel для PHP.
Создание макетов дизайна включает выбор цветовой палитры, шрифтов и других элементов интерфейса. Важно следить за современными тенденциями в web дизайне, но при этом не терять уникальности и соответствие бренду. Макеты могут быть созданы в графических редакторах, таких как Adobe Photoshop или Sketch, а также с помощью специализированных инструментов для web дизайна, например, Figma.
Реализация макетов осуществляется с использованием HTML, CSS и JavaScript. Для улучшения кроссбраузерной совместимости и адаптивности могут быть применены препроцессоры, такие как Sass или Less для CSS, а также библиотеки и фреймворки, например, Bootstrap.
Тестирование сайта на различных устройствах и браузерах является обязательным этапом перед запуском. Это включает проверку функциональности, производительности и отсутствие ошибок. Важно также учитывать адаптивность дизайна для мобильных устройств, так как значительная часть трафика приходит с них.
Заключительным этапом является запуск сайта и его продвижение. Это включает регистрацию домена, подключение хостинга и настройку DNS-записей. Продвижение может осуществляться через SEO, контекстную рекламу, социальные сети и другие каналы.
Таким образом, создание своего сайта и дизайна требует тщательного планирования, выбора подходящих технологий и инструментов, а также внимания к деталям на всех этапах разработки.